MATLAB 2016b Doc Set Throwable on Startup

Recently on start up of MATLAB 2016b, I began receiving the following message in the command window:
"Caught throwable while adding doc set item to doc set builder: null"
Tried restoring defaults on paths, preferences, ect... I've also been digging around in the javaclasspaths and the matlab log file but haven't been able to find any information on this problem.
